Internal hemorrhoids rarely cause pain (and typically can't be felt) unless they prolapse. Many people with internal hemorrhoids don't know they have them because they don't have symptoms. If you have symptoms of internal hemorrhoids, you might see blood on toilet paper, in stool or the toilet bowl. WebThe most common symptoms of hemorrhoids include the following: Painless rectal bleeding, usually is a small amount. Anal itching or pain, due to irritation of the skin surrounding the anus. Tissue bulging around the anus, some people can see or feel hemorrhoids on the outside of the anus. Leakage of feces or difficulty cleaning after a …
